Due to the way wp-cli modifies the wp-config.php when loading, and the fact that Windows allows single quotes in account names, a user with a single quote in their account name will get fatal errors when the wp-config.php const replacement ends up like this:
Notice the single quote in the username breaking the quoted path.
More details on this issue can be found here: #1631
